DOLL DELAY HAS MADE MY BLOOD BOIL
October 12, 2025
|Liverpool Sunday Echo
Alder Hey fundraiser's anger after mix-up puts his display on hold

A DAD who spends thousands of pounds decorating his home for Halloween to raise money for Alder Hey Children's Hospital has had to put his display on hold thanks to a "mix-up" by Asda.
John Sawtell, from Prescot, says he "loves" Halloween and every year spends thousands decorating his home with his wife.
John's spooky decor started out with a "few bits" and over the years has grown into a huge display, that has cost him thousands. This year, he decided to order two new "props" from George at Asda to add to his display.
He said: "I'd spotted these two drops online, they were quite cheap, one was a butler and one was a girl, dressed in black and holding a brown teddy bear [described on George website as Halloween Animated 3ft Haunted Doll]. I ordered them from George, I got the confirmation as normal, with a picture of each item confirming what I'd ordered.
"They were due to get delivered a few days later. I got an email saying 'sorry, there's a delay with your George order' I didn't think anything of it, then a few days later my order arrived."
